Are any of the Mommas and the Pappas still alive?
Phillips is the only surviving member of The Mamas and the Papas. Elliot died in 1974. She reunited with her ex-husband John and former lover Doherty in 1998 for The Mamas and the Papas’ induction into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ame. John passed away in 2001 and Doherty died in 2007.

When were the Mamas and Papas on Ed Sullivan?
“ For their first appearance, on December 11th 1966, they performed their number one hits, “Monday, Monday” and “California Dreaming” as well as “Words of Love.” As soon as their performance ended, they knew they had hit the big time.

Why was Cass Elliot called Mama Cass?
Elliot’s early life was spent with her family in Alexandria, Virginia, before the family moved to Baltimore when Elliot was 15, and where they had briefly lived at the time of Elliot’s birth. Elliot adopted the name “Cass” in high school, possibly borrowing it from actress Peggy Cass, according to Denny Doherty.
Who are the Mamas and the Papas?
The Mamas and the Papas were formed by husband and wife John Phillips (formerly of the New Journeymen) and Michelle Phillips, and Denny Doherty (formerly of the Mugwumps ). Both of these earlier acts were folk groups active in 1964 and 1965.

What happened to the Mamas&the Papas?
The recording sessions for the fourth album stalled, and in September 1967 John Phillips called a press conference to announce that the Mamas & the Papas were taking a break, which the band confirmed on The Ed Sullivan Show that aired September 24.
